How to: Make a Polka Dotted Cake!

tutorial-tuesday2

CAKEa

Make a batch of royal icing and color it as you wish.

cakedots2-1

Scoop the icing into a piping bag and using a small round tip, pipe dots of different sizes onto a cookie sheet lined with parchment paper.

cakedots3

Leave them overnight to harden and then carefully pick them up with a thin spatula and place them wherever you like on your cake.

cakedots1

If you are piping letters or numbers it would be helpful to print out the letters on a sheet of paper and slide it under the parchment sheet.. it will serve as a guide for you to follow with your piping bag.
